Nuclear energy has long stood at the intersection of promise and controversy. From concerns over safety and public perception to its evolving place in global clean energy strategies, the conversation around nuclear is rarely straightforward. In this episode, Girish Shivakumar sits down with Richard Orlington of Radiant Energy Group — a veteran energy analyst tracking the global power sector — to separate fact from fiction.

We explore:
  • Why nuclear’s public narrative has shifted from weapons and accidents to clean, firm energy
  • The lifecycle and real timelines behind nuclear project development
  • How energy policies around the world are beginning to re-embrace nuclear
  • The role nuclear can play in stabilizing the grid alongside renewables
  • Common myths that continue to hold back progress in the sector
  • What the data actually shows about nuclear’s cost, safety, and scalability

Richard brings a rare systems-level view of the energy transition, blending technical insight with global policy awareness. Whether you’re pro-nuclear, anti-nuclear, or undecided, this episode offers a balanced, data-driven lens through which to understand nuclear’s evolving role.
